Consumer reporter Nathan Fielder reports on mp3 players. Made for "This Hour Has 22 Minutes".

@thewarnerchannel72854 ай бұрын
Nathan proving he can break the "yes and" rule of improv and still be hilarious!
@nikita2560
4 ай бұрын
Can you explain what you mean?
@thewarnerchannel7285
4 ай бұрын
@@nikita2560 Conventional teaching is that in improv you should never say "no" because the sketch would end and wouldn't be funny, you should always say "yes and", adding something on top of your partner's prompt, but Nathan does the opposite and just keeps telling the guy no no no, in complete defiance of the rule, and it's still hilarious!
